The Feria de Abril Festival in Seville, Spain, is one of the most popular and vibrant celebrations in the country. This annual festival, also known as the April Fair, attracts visitors from around the world who come to experience the colorful and lively atmosphere that engulfs the city during the event.
The origins of the Feria de Abril Festival date back to the 19th century when it was established as a livestock fair. Over the years, it has evolved into a week-long celebration that combines traditional Andalusian culture with modern festivities.
One of the highlights of the Feria de Abril Festival is the stunning fairground, known as the "Real de la Feria," which is transformed into a dazzling display of lights, decorations, and lively music. The fairground features rows of brightly colored tents, or "casetas," where locals and visitors gather to dance flamenco, enjoy traditional food and drinks, and socialize with friends and family.
Traditional Andalusian attire plays a significant role in the festival, with men wearing traditional suits called "trajes cortos" and women donning elegant flamenco dresses. Visitors are encouraged to join in the fun by dressing in traditional clothing and immersing themselves in the rich cultural heritage of the region.
Throughout the week, the Feria de Abril Festival hosts a variety of events and activities, including horse parades, bullfights, flamenco performances, and live music concerts. The streets are adorned with colorful decorations, and the air is filled with the sounds of laughter, music, and celebration.
For food enthusiasts, the festival offers a wide array of delicious Andalusian dishes to sample, including traditional tapas, fried fish, and mouthwatering pastries. Visitors can indulge in local specialties while soaking up the festive atmosphere of the Feria de Abril Festival.
